Rhetan TMT Secures BIS Certification and Completes Solar Project to Support Growth

Analysed 27 Jul 2026·2 sources analysed·Ahmedabad, India·Business
Rhetan TMT Secures BIS Certification and Completes Solar Project to Support GrowthPreviousNext

Rhetan TMT Ltd has received BIS certification to manufacture premium-grade Fe500D, Fe550, and Fe550D TMT bars, enabling it to supply high-strength steel for government and infrastructure projects. This certification expands its product portfolio and market access, particularly in large-scale construction. Additionally, the company completed a 1 MW captive solar power project to reduce energy costs and support sustainable manufacturing. Despite nearing a 52-week high, the company's shares retraced recently amid growing steel demand in India.
